Modes Supported by TV Encoders
Table A.3 and Table A.4 list the NTSC, PAL, and HDTV TV-Out modes supported by the
NVIDIA driver.
The driver supports manual overscan correction for component and DVI outputs. See the
ForceWare Graphics Driver User’s Guide for instructions on how to use the overscan
correction features in the control panel.
Table A.3 Mode Support for S-Video and Composite Out
Resolution Bit
depth
Comments
320 × 200 8, 16, 32 DirectDraw mode; not selectable as a Windows
desktop
320 × 240 8, 16, 32 DirectDraw mode; not selectable as a Windows
desktop
640 × 400 8, 16, 32 DirectDraw mode; not selectable as a Windows
desktop
640 × 480 8, 16, 32
720 × 480 8, 16, 32 Overscans (for video)
720 × 576 8, 16, 32 Overscans (for video)
800 × 600 8, 16, 32
1024 × 768 8, 16, 32 Conexant 25871 only
